Output 59d06d018fa79ecfc3c718f73a8ebe38afc1dd3b4bad1b2cf23e720bd57599d8:0

value
31427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 889965f5aa52b0f629dd416faa4456a6a5369576 OP_EQUAL
address
3E9Haw1anJcgnxanyH2wSqAuAucdQKihvN
transaction
59d06d018fa79ecfc3c718f73a8ebe38afc1dd3b4bad1b2cf23e720bd57599d8
spent
true